Size and Proportion

The size of your lamp shade should be proportional to the base of your lamp. A general rule of thumb is that the shade should be about two-thirds the height of the base. For table lamps, the shade's width should also be roughly equal to the height of the base. For floor lamps, a larger shade is generally appropriate. Small shades work well on desk lamps or bedside tables, while larger shades are better suited for floor lamps or buffet lamps. Consider the overall scale of the room and the furniture around the lamp to ensure a balanced look.

Shape and Style

The shape of your lamp shade can significantly impact the overall style of your lamp and room. Drum shades offer a modern and clean look, while empire shades provide a more traditional and elegant feel. Round shades are versatile and can work with various lamp styles, while square shades add a contemporary touch.

  • Drum Shades: These shades have a cylindrical shape and offer a clean, modern aesthetic. They work well with contemporary and minimalist decor styles.

  • Empire Shades: These shades have a classic, conical shape that is wider at the bottom than at the top. They offer a traditional and elegant look and are suitable for formal living rooms or bedrooms.

  • Round Shades: These shades are versatile and can complement various lamp styles. They provide a soft and diffused light, making them ideal for creating a relaxing atmosphere.

  • Square Shades: These shades offer a contemporary and geometric look. They work well with modern and eclectic decor styles.

Material and Light

The material of your lamp shade affects the quality and intensity of the light it emits. Linen shades provide a soft, diffused light that is perfect for creating a cozy atmosphere. Silk shades offer a more luxurious look and feel, while also providing a warm and inviting glow. For a more textured look, consider shades with ribbed or patterned fabrics. Darker shades will block more light, while lighter shades will allow more light to pass through. Consider linen shades for a soft, diffused glow, or silk shades for a touch of luxury.

Fitter Types: Clip-On, Uno, Spider, and Harp

Lamp shades come with various fitter types, each designed to attach to the lamp in a specific way. Clip-on fitters are easy to install and are suitable for small lamps or chandeliers. Uno fitters attach directly to the lamp socket and are commonly used for table lamps. Spider fitters require a harp, which sits around the bulb and provides a stable base for the shade. Choosing the right fitter type ensures that your lamp shade is securely attached and functions properly.
